Karma on Reddit is essentially a reputation score that reflects your contributions and interactions within the community. It is divided into two types: Post Karma and Comment Karma.
Post Karma: This is earned when you post links or text posts that receive upvotes. The more upvotes your post gets, the higher your Post Karma will be. Conversely, downvotes will decrease your Post Karma.
Comment Karma: This is earned from the upvotes and downvotes on your comments. Positive contributions that resonate with the community will increase your Comment Karma, while negative or controversial comments may decrease it.
Karma serves as a metric to showcase one's agreeability or influence within the Reddit community. It can also be seen as a measure of your account's reputation. Higher karma often indicates that you are contributing valuable content or engaging in meaningful discussions.Additionally, karma can be influenced by the awards you receive on your posts or comments. These awards are given by other users and can also contribute to your overall karma score.In summary, karma on Reddit is a reflection of your participation and the community's response to your contributions. It helps in identifying active and valuable members of the community.
